How to Get By on One Income When Baby Arrives

For the Mommas

Parents-to-be can easily overspend on baby items; adding hundreds of dollars to the household budget. Goodwill and thrift stores offer great prices on new and gently used items. Nursery furniture and toys can be picked up at a fraction of the price. Buy second hand. Check with friends and co-workers for needed items.
